IIya at Ivy and Rose (formerly My Diamond Zone) is helping me repurpose my original engagement stone into a pendant. The diamond is .75 round, color H. Very very strong fluro and I1 clarity.

The ring: img_6391_0.jpg

I went back and forth on rocky talky about what I wanted, which was a 3 stone pendant. But in all the talking with people and vendors, I decided to keep it a one stone and I knew I wanted a bezel and miligrain with accent stones.
